The NJIC has made its presence quite felt in the NJSIAA State Sectional Bowling Tournament. Four conference schools claimed titles in North 1A and North 1B. Glen Rock HS captured the Group-2 North 1A title. The Panthers are ranked #1 in the Record area team poll....
